Valuables worth Tk6 lakh stolen from Dakshinkhan in daylight

Dhaka, May 3 --Valuables and cash worth nearly Tk 6 lakh were stolen from a house in the Dakshinkhan area of Dhaka in broad daylight on Saturday.

According to the victim, Mohammad Ali Gazi, the thieves entered the house between 7am and 8am and stole the money and other valuables.

Later, Mohammad Ali filed a general diary (GD) at the Dakshinkhan police station on Saturday night.

In the GD, Mohammad Ali mentioned that he left home for work at around 6:30 am, followed shortly by his wife, who went to visit her sister. Later, Mohammad Ali's father-in-law, who had returned home from his eldest daughter's house, discovered that the main door was broken and informed him by phone.

Upon receiving the call, Mohammad Ali quickly returned home and found the inside of the house in disarray, with belongings scattered everywhere.

The stolen items included 7,500 Saudi Riyals, Tk 1,50,000, and other valuables. - UNB
